Ceramic is also a good choice for bakeware and dishes because it is non-toxic and resistant to heat, but it can be prone to chipping and breaking. Glass is a safe and durable choice for bakeware, storage containers, and drinking glasses, but it can also be prone to breaking. Silicone is a heat-resistant and non-stick material that is often used for bakeware and cooking utensils, but it can be prone to melting at high temperatures. It is important to use caution when handling any kitchenware and to follow the manufacturer's instructions for use and care to ensure safety.

Use panels or fronts that match the cabinetry: This is a popular option for refrigerators, dishwashers, and other large appliances. The panels or fronts can be custom-made to match the rest of the kitchen cabinets, creating a seamless look.Install appliances in a separate, hidden space: If you have the space, you can create a separate area in your kitchen where appliances are stored. This could be a pantry, utility room, or even a small closet.Use appliances that are designed to blend in: There are many appliances, such as induction cooktops and downdraft vents, that are designed to be integrated into the countertop or other surfaces in the kitchen. These appliances are often less obtrusive and can help to create a more streamlined look.

Use surge protectors: Surge protectors are devices that help to protect appliances from sudden spikes in voltage. They can be used to protect individual appliances or to protect multiple appliances at once.Unplug appliances during thunderstorms: Thunderstorms can cause voltage fluctuations, so it's a good idea to unplug appliances during storms to help protect them.
